There doesn't appear to be any pattern to this, but when I am downloading new MP3s into iTunes (9.0.2) either from Amazon or eMusic, some of them come in normally and some of them come in without allowing me to edit any of the song information. This can happen even within one album, when all the songs are arriving in the library during the same download session. And yet some allow editing and some don't.
When I right-click on Get Info for either the album's folder or any of the individual files having this problem, it still tells me that I can read and write, under Ownership & Permissions.
Anyone have any ideas how to re-establish editing capability under these circumstances?
actually, i started a thread sometime ago about that exact same problem - with no result. in the end i waited it out and, since upgrading to iTunes 9.x, all is back to normal. no help to you at this point but ... just so you know you're not alone.
what you can try (and i did not at the time - so your milage may vary) is this by *Chris CA*
+Quit iTunes.+
+Open a Finder window.+
+Go to \Music\ folder.+
+Right click the \iTunes\ folder and Get info.+
+Go to the Sharing & Permissions tab.+
+Make sure your username has Read & Write privileges.+
+Directly below are ( + ) and ( - ) signs next to a little gear with a down arrow+
+Click the gear and select Apply to enclosed items.+
+Open iTunes then try again.+
does that work for you ?

    How do I download Ebooks from Amazon and read in IBook? I know there is a Kindle app for my IPad. But I like to use IBook for reading? Must I do some kind of conversion? If so how? The kind of books I read are more likely to be on amazon than in the IBook store.

    I use Calibre all the time. As others have said: e-books purchased from Apple's iBookstore have Apple DRM unless the publisher specifically offered a DRM-free e-book. Kindle e-books have both an Amazon proprietary format and may have Kindle DRM too. None of these protected formats can be legally converted to anything else.  If you have an e-book in open EPUB format, it should read fine on the iOS iBook devices, but it will never read on the Kindle becuase Bezos has said the Kindle will never support EPUB.
    If you have a non-DRM protected e-book file in EPUB or any other format including some word processor files, chances are that Calibre can convert it to a readable file on the iPad, iPhone, Kobo or Kindle devices. Calibre is a format converter. Just play around with the source and destination menus on Calibre.
    How well the book looks on the iBook or Kindle or whatever-reading device depends more on the quality of the source file than anything Apple does. I hope this helps.
